Уведомления

Группа в Telegram: @pythonsu
  • Начало
  • » GUI
  • » Tkinter. Удалить последний символ из Entry() [RSS Feed]

#1 Апрель 10, 2014 11:50:20

MetalHead
От: Ленгер
Зарегистрирован: 2013-12-17
Сообщения: 88
Репутация: +  1  -
Профиль   Отправить e-mail  

Tkinter. Удалить последний символ из Entry()

Добрый день, пишу калькулятор на данном GUI, необходимо удалить один последний символ из виджета Entry(), делаю так:

self.entry_display.delete(END)
Пожалуйста дайте точные координаты.

Офлайн

#2 Апрель 10, 2014 13:19:55

4kpt_II
От: Харьков
Зарегистрирован: 2013-10-24
Сообщения: 999
Репутация: +  58  -
Профиль   Отправить e-mail  

Tkinter. Удалить последний символ из Entry()

Просто

self.entry_display.delete(len(self.entry_display.get()) - 1)

Или

self.entry_display.delete(self.entry_display.index("insert") - 1)

Отредактировано 4kpt_II (Апрель 10, 2014 13:26:52)

Офлайн

#3 Апрель 13, 2014 11:41:36

MetalHead
От: Ленгер
Зарегистрирован: 2013-12-17
Сообщения: 88
Репутация: +  1  -
Профиль   Отправить e-mail  

Tkinter. Удалить последний символ из Entry()

Спасибо, проблема решена.

Офлайн

  • Начало
  • » GUI
  • » Tkinter. Удалить последний символ из Entry()[RSS Feed]

Board footer

Модераторировать

Powered by DjangoBB

Lo-Fi Version